VISAKHAPATNAM: Gangavaram Port is committed to assist initiatives towards improving health and sanitation of rural public and in particular towards providing bio-toilets and drinking water facilities to Govt. Girls Schools in rural areas of Visakhapatnam District.
Gangavaram Port has now made a contribution of Rs.12.5 Lakhs for construction of bio-toilets and setting up of RO facilities for providing drinking water at ZP school for Girls in Visakhapatnam District.
The contribution is made through Social Awareness Newer Alternatives (SANA foundation), an NGO identified by district administration of Visakhapatnam.
A cheque for Rs. 12.5 Lakhs was handed over to Dist. Collector, Visakhapatnam by Vice President (Liaison) L.P.S. Ramu Naidu on 27.12.2017 for this purpose.
